How do you find the cube root of 216?

How do you find the cube root of 216?

Since 216 can be expressed as 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3. Therefore, the cube root of 216 = ∛(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3) = 6.

IS 216 a perfect square?

216 is a number that is not a perfect square, meaning it does not have a natural number as its square root. Also, its square root cannot be expressed as a fraction of the form p/q which tells us that the square root of 216 is an irrational number.

What is the factors of 216?

The factors of 216 are 1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 8, 9, 12, 18, 24, 27, 36, 54, 72, 108 and 216. Therefore, the common factor of 216 and 215 is 1.

How do you simplify 216?

We know that the prime factorisation of 216 is 23 × 33. Therefore, the simplest radical form of value of the square root of 216 is √(23 × 33), which is equal to 6√6. Square Root of 216 in Radical Form: 6√6.
